The NFB’s interactive documentary game Fort McMoney opens its second episode today. Head here to play.

On International Holocaust Remembrance Day, the Holocaust Museum offers a free screening of the locally made, Oscar-nominated short The Lady in Number 6. For a full list of this year’s Oscar-nominated Montrealers, look here.  5151 Cote Ste-Catherine, 7 p.m., free

Cinema Politica screen The Beginning & Taksim Commune, two docs that beautifully tell the story of the recent social mobilization in Turkey and reveal Gezi point as a flashpoint in ongoing political activism. D.B. Clarke Theatre (1455 de Maisonneuve W.), 7 p.m., suggested donation $2–$5

If you’re seeking out a unique sonic experience tonight, consider the Afro-Latino rhythms and avant-garde soundscapes of local septet Avec le Soleil Sortant de sa Bouche, with openers Woodsman. Casa del Popolo (4873 St-Laurent), 9 p.m., $8/$10
